Family Reading Partners is a non-profit organization based in Orange County, NC, dedicated to fostering early literacy by empowering parents to support their children’s learning through shared reading and meaningful conversations. Our Home Visiting Program supports families with children from birth to kindergarten, providing quarterly visits where children receive books and educational toys, and parents receive guidance on activities and best practices to promote language and literacy development. These efforts aim to foster a love of reading, interactive play, and meaningful family connections.
